Navigating Pregnancy Safely, One Resource at a Time.

Drugs in Pregnancy and Lactation: A Reference Guide to Fetal and Neonatal Risk is a trusted and comprehensive guide for expecting parents and healthcare professionals. This essential reference empowers informed decisions regarding medication use during pregnancy and breastfeeding. By providing up-to-date, evidence-based information on drug safety, this book is an invaluable tool for both anticipating potential risks and making proactive choices that protect the health of mothers and newborns.
